Cabbage chutney/Cabbage pachadi/Elekossu Chutney

Cabbage Chutney/Cabbage Pachadi/Elekossu Chutney is a very healthy chutney goes well with Idli,Dosa,Chapathi and rice. Many of us don't like the smell of Cabbage and we do not prepare much varieties with this vegetable. But this cabbage contains many healthy vitamins in it. So,don't ignore it and try to add it in salads,snacks,curries and Chutneys. In this recipe, I am adding tamarind to add a tangy tinge to the cabbage,which makes it tasty and yummy.

Nutritional Benefits of Cabbage/Elekossu : Cabbage is very nutritious and is very low in calories.It is rich in Phyto Chemicals like thiocyanates, indole-3-carbinol, lutein, zea-xanthin, sulforaphane, and isothiocyanates,which are powerful anti-oxidant, which helps  in protecting against colon,breat and prostate cancer. This vegetable also contains another power antioxidant Vitamin C and also Panthotenic acid,pyridoxin,thiamin.It is also a good source of Vitamin K and minerals like potassium, manganese, iron, and magnesium.

Preparation time : 10 mins

Cooking time : 15 mins

Yield : 2

Ingredients :

Cabbage : 1 (small floret)

Red chilies/ endu mirchi/ ona menasinakayi  :  7-9 no

Salt : to taste

Turmeric powder/pasupu/arishana pudi : a pinch

Tamarind : small ball size

Asafoetida : a pinch

Oil : 1 tbsp + 1tsp

Mustard seeds : 1 tsp

Cumin seeds : 1 tsp

Curry leaves : few

 Method of Preparation :

  1. Clean and chop cabbage into small pieces.

  2. Heat  a tbsp of oil in a kadai ,add 6-7 red chilies,fry them and take them into a plate.In the same kadai,add chopped cabbage pieces,cook for 3-5 mins,then add tamarind,pinch of turmeric powder,close the kadai with a lid and cook for 5 more minutes.

  3. Switch off the flame and cool the mixture. Once it is cooled grind fried red chilies,cabbage pieces along with tamarind and salt into chutney.

  4. Add a tsp of oil in another kadai,splutter mustard seeds, then add cumin seeds,red chilies,curry leaves and asafoetida,saute for 30 secs - 1 minute. Add this tempering to the chutney.

  5. Dish out and serve with Idli,dosa,chapathi or rice.

Spicy Curry Leaves Powder/Karivepaku Karam/Karibevu Pudi

 This Spicy Curry leaves powder/kadi patta/karivepaku/karibevu podi is a rich aromatic, highly nutritious and low calorie powder,which we can prepare easily and it can be stored up to 1 month in an air tight container. This powder is a perfect combination for Idli,Dosa and it tastes perfect with hot rice & ghee/oil. We usually ignore the curry leaves in the seasoning and we just throw them,without eating,but these are very nutritious.This Curry leaves powder is a spicy combination made  with curry leaves,spices and also tamarind  to add a touch of tangy flavor

Health Benefits of Curry Leaves/kadi patti/karivepaku/karibevu : These curry leaves are a  rich source of Iron and Folic acid,which are mainly responsible  for preventing Anemia. Rich source of Vitamin A and C.Helps in controlling Diabetics with the help of their anti-diabetic properties.Also helps in lowering bad cholesterol and increasing good cholesterol.These also contain high levels of anti-oxidants which helps in preventing Cancer.Helps in improving digestion.Also helps in relieving congestion of chest and nose.Also helps in preventing premature greying of hair.

Preparation time : 30 mins

Ingredients :

Curry leaves : 2 cups (only leaves,without stalk)

Cumin seeds/jeera/jeerige : 2 tbsp

Bengal gram/senaga pappu/kadale bele : 10 tbsp

Red chilies/endu mirchi/ona menasinakayi : 9-10 no

Coriander seeds/dhaniyalu/dhaniya : 2 tbsp

Black gram/minapappu/uddhina bele : 10 tbsp

Tamarind : lemon sized ball

Salt : to taste

Oil : 1 1/2 tbsp

Method Of Preparation :

  1. Clean and dry curry leaves in shade for 1 hr and keep aside.

  2. Heat 1/2 tbsp of oil and add cumin seeds,coriander seeds, fry till they slightly change their color.Remove them and cool them.

  3. Then add bengal gram,black gram,red chilies in to the same kadai,fry till they turn light brown by tossing continuously. Remove these also and cool them.Add 1 tbsp of oil to the kadai,add curry leaves and fry til the curry leaves turn crispy.Cool them.

  4. First grind bengal gram and black gram coarsely and then add red chilies,cumin seeds,coriander seeds to it and grind once again.Then add tamarind and salt,grind one more time and remove this mixture and keep aside.Now grind curry leaves into powder.Now add the ground dal mixture to curry leaves powder,blend once again,remove into an airtight container and store.

  5. This goes very well with hot rice and ghee.It also goes well with idli,dosa and  can even add this powder to the chapathi dough and can  make a tasty and spicy chapathi.

Note : All the ingredients should be cooled before grinding.

Simple Tomato Chutney

Today I am sharing the easiest version of preparing tomato chutney. I have already shared coriander- tomato chutney recipe, which is a combination of tomatoes with coriander leaves in my earlier post.This is one of the authentic chutney recipe which is often prepared in our home. The tangy taste of tomatoes blended with onions,red chilies,curry leaves makes an absolute combination for Idli,dosa,chapathi especially with akki roti. Among all other chutneys,tomato chutney occupies a special place,because of its delicious taste.

Preparation Time : 10 mins

Cooking Time : 20 mins

Yield : 2

Ingredients :

Tomatoes : 1/4 kg

Red chilies/endu mirchi/ona menasinakayi : 7-9 no.

Onion pieces : 1 cup (100 gm)

Crushed garlic : 4-5 no

Tamarind pulp : 3 tbsp

Salt : as per taste

Curry leaves : fist ful

Asafoetida : a pinch

Mustard seeds/sasive/avallu : 1 tsp

Cumin seeds/jeera/jeerige : 1 tsp

Oil :   1 tsp

Method of Preparation:

  1. Chop tomatoes into small pieces.Extract tamarind pulp by soaking tamarind in hot/cold water for 10 mins.

  2. Heat 1/2 tsp of Oil in a kadai, add red chilies,crushed garlic,onion pieces and saute for 3-4 minutes. Then add chopped tomato pieces, cook till they become soft. Then put  off the flame, add tamarind pulp and let it cool down.

  3. once it is cooled,grind it by adding enough amount of salt, into a paste in a blender(if required,add little water). Remove it into a bowl and keep aside.

  4. In another kadai,add 1/2 tsp of oil ,crackle mustard seeds,then add cumin seeds,curry leaves and asafoetida,fry for 2-3 mins.Then add chutney into this tempering and mix well. Dish out and serve along with Idli,dosa or akki roti.

Coriander-Tomato chutney/Tomato-Kothmir Chutney/Tomato-Kothambari Soppu Chutney

Today I am sharing one of my favorite Chutney recipe which is coriander-tomato chutney. For the first time I have tasted this chutney at my dearest friend's house.From then onward I was stuck by its taste. With very few ingredients we can make this  super tasty chutney. Both Tomato and Coriander leaves has many health benefits. I would like to discuss few benefits here.

Nutritional Benefits of Tomatoes : These contain lots of vitamins,minerals,dietary fiber and especially  antioxidants which acts as an anticancer agent, by eliminating the free radicals and thus preventing from cancer.These also contain high amounts of Vitamin A and C which helps in protecting our eyes and skin from damage. These also contain trace amounts of Iron,folate/folic acid,potassium,calcium, thiamin, niacin , riboflavin,manganese etc.,

Nutritional Benefits of Coriander Leaves : These leaves help in lowering the glucose level and thus helpful for diabetic patients. Helps in controlling gastric problems,UTI (urinary tract infections),nausea,vomiting, indigestion problem. It is also a great source of fiber,Iron,phyto nutrients,flavonoids,magnesium which are essential for healthy body.

 

Preparation time : 10 Minutes

Cooking time : 20 Minutes

Yield : 2

 

Ingredients :

Tomatoes : 3 (large)

Green chilies : 5

Bengal gram/ pachi senaga pappu/Kadale bele : 1 tbsp

Salt : to taste

Cumin seeds /jeerige/jeera : 1 tbsp

oil : 1 tbsp

Coriander leaves : Half cup

Tamarind / chintapandu/hunse hannu : small lemon size ball

 

Method of Preparation :

  1. First chop tomatoes and green chilies and keep them aside.

  2. Heat a small kadai, add 1 tbsp of oil and heat it, then add cumin seeds/jeerige/jeera and bengal gram/pachi senaga pappu/ Kadale bele and fry for  half minute and take them into a plate/bowl and keep aside.

  3. In the same kadai add tomato pieces,green chillies and  cover with lid and cook for 5 minutes or till the tomatoes turn soft.

  4. To this add coriander leaves/kothmir/kothumbari soppu and cook for one more minute and then add tamarind ball to it and once again close the lid and cook for 1 minute and then stop the flame and let them cool.

  5. In a mixer jar add fried cumin seeds and bengal gram and grind it. Then to this add remaining ingredients (tomatoes,coriander leaves,tamarind,green chilies) and the required amount of salt and once again grind and make into paste.

  6. If necessary add little water also to make paste.

  7. Dish out and serve along with Idly/dosa/plain rice.
